ISLAMABAD: Pakistan Muslim League-Nawaz (PML-N) MPs have assured Prime Minister Nawaz Sharif that they will resist the opponents of progress.
All of them rose up to warmly welcome the prime minister who enters the auditorium with his secretary Fawad Hassan Fawad and gave him a standing ovation be fore start of the PML-N parliamanrary party meeting on Thursday. Chaudhry Asadur Rehman said he is not able hear the PM properly on which the PM asked him to sit down.
The PM said success comes with hard work and not sit-ins. Nawaz was confident all through the proceedings of the meeting. It was proposed that Musharraf and his colleagues should be called in to ask why they have not installed plants to generate electricity in their time. They praised Operation Zarb-e-Azb and the role of police in countering terrorism.
